Two confederates meet on the battlefield and become friends during the Civil War. After the conflict is over, the men go west to make a new start. War-weary and restless, they find it hard to settle down. Their journey takes them to Texas where they find work as rangers, then to Kansas, hunting buffalo, and finally to Montana, to see and experience the gold camps there.Gun and shooting enthusiasts will enjoy the characters and the gunfights using the fine rifles and pistols of the day – the Sharps, Winchesters, Henrys and more. History buffs will appreciate the accuracy of historical facts throughout Lloyd’s Montana saga.This novel contains black and white photos from the Library of Congress and other sources.
